Local SEO: The Lead Engine
Local SEO is essential for businesses targeting a specific area. It helps you connect with customers who are ready to take action. By optimizing your local presence, you can appear in map listings and location-based searches, increasing your chances of conversions.
What to Optimize:
- Google Business Profile
- Location-based keywords (city, area)
- Customer reviews and ratings
- Business directories and citations

Technical SEO (Quick Wins Checklist)
Technical SEO ensures that your website is accessible, fast, and easy for search engines to crawl. Without it, even great content can struggle to rank. Fixing technical issues can lead to quick improvements in rankings and performance.
Quick Fixes:
- Improve website loading speed
- Ensure mobile responsiveness
- Use HTTPS for security
- Fix broken links and errors
- Optimize images with alt text
- Submit sitemap to Google
AI + SEO: The New Reality
Artificial Intelligence is transforming how search engines rank content. It focuses on understanding context rather than just keywords. Businesses that adapt to AI-driven SEO strategies will dominate search results in the coming years.
How to Adapt:
- Use natural, conversational language
- Answer specific user questions clearly
- Optimize for featured snippets
- Structure content logically
SEO vs Paid Ads
SEO and paid ads both play important roles in digital marketing. However, relying only on ads can be expensive and unsustainable. SEO provides long-term growth, while ads deliver quick results.
Comparison:
- SEO builds long-term visibility and authority
- Paid ads provide instant traffic
- SEO reduces long-term costs
- Ads require continuous investment
